*originally recorded on 2-9-26*
Signal on the left: 2 pairs of Safetran 12x20 inch lights, a Safetran Type 3 electronic bell, a Safetran gate mechanism, and RECO gate lights.
Signal on the right: 2 pairs of Safetran 12x20 inch lights, a dying Safetran mechanical bell, a Safetran gate mechanism, and RECO LED gate lights.
After catching A81 in Ryland, I knew they were going to stop to work at Chase, so I decided to continue on west to see if I could catch-up with 733 and beat it somewhere. Thankfully, I was able to get ahead of the empty coal train heading across the Tennessee River into Decatur, so I decided to race on over to this crossing to see if I could get them here. Thankfully, I was able to beat them with a bit of time to spare, and here we see this NS 733 with a friendly crew once again.
Thankfully, nothing has changed to this crossing since I last recorded it. Nice to see that the Safetran mechanical bell here is still hanging on.
